Wataru Muro is a researcher focused on the intersection of optical networking, cloud computing, and distributed resource coordination. His most-cited work, "Application-Triggered Automatic Distributed Cloud/Network Resource Coordination by Optically Networked Inter/Intra Data Center" (2018, 10 citations), addresses the growing demand for seamless connectivity as everything from IoT devices to network robots and big data analytics migrates to the cloud. Muro’s key contribution lies in proposing architectures that enable automatic, application-driven orchestration of both cloud and network resources across optically networked inter- and intra-data center environments. This work is particularly relevant as mega-cloud data centers from companies like Amazon and Google evolve to handle increasingly complex, latency-sensitive services. By tackling the challenge of dynamic resource allocation in optically interconnected infrastructures, Muro helps pave the way for more efficient, scalable cloud networks.
